动物实验利与弊 论点1:(正方)不人道First of all,the main disadvantage of animal testing is the inhumane treatment of animals in tests due to the fact that anesthesia for the help of pain is often not used. Scientists say that using anesthesia will interfere with test results. Today the term “vivisection” is used. Vivisection is defined as “cutting while still alive” but it is more commonly used today as any harmful experiment or test that is performed on an animal. Animal experimentation involves the incarceration of animals and poisoning, mutilation, disease and killing of those individuals. It is arguably the most brutal and most severe form of violence in the modern world. It is said that an estimated 50,000 animals die due to the testing on them. Some of the tests that IAMS performed were: 28 female cats had their abdomens(腹部) cut open and solution injected repeatedly into their bowels. 24 young dogs were given kidney failure by the removal of one kidney and the damaging of the other. All the dogs were killed after being fed an experimental diet and their kidneys analyzed. 论点2:(正方)可有别的措施Many alternatives already exist, and there must be many more which are waiting to be found. The day will surely come when not more experiments on animals will need to be done for human medicine. its hared to say there will always be alternatives for veterinary research, The most common alternatives that are used today are: in-vitro tests, computer software, and even human “clinical tests”. The use of animal cells, organs, and tissue cultures are also deemed as alternatives, (反驳正方)however animal lives are still sacrificed for the use of their parts. We can only talk about banning experimentation when the alternatives have been proved to be accurate, and safe. → (反方反驳)As a medical student, Ive realized that artificial means can never replace the incredible complexity of living animals. It may not be possible to ban all animal tests quite yet, but there should be a lot more money, time and efforts going into finding alternatives. 新论点3:正方:动物也有权利Could anyone tell me why humans are more important than any other animals? If you answered Yes to ALL of the above, then you are free from hypocrisy(伪善,虚伪) in your moral stance(l立场姿态). 论点1:我们需要动物实验Animals testing is really necessary. 分论点(1)患者的需要First of all , all the patients are in the need of the testing. Why? Could you realize that the animals you believe are being harmed, have not only impacted your lives in some way, but have impacted your families, friends, by providing people with vaccines and antibiotics. When it comes down to it, rightly or wrongly, we will all happily sacrifice an animal in order to save a loved one! Millions of lives are saved every year because of one animal’s, results to either a drug or new form of surgery. Tell me that Which would you prefer to live - an ill child or a healthy bunny? With rights come responsibilities - what responsibilities to animals have? How many people who advocate banning animal testing have accepted medicines which have almost surely been tested on animals. A move towards animal rights means a move away from human rights. 分论点(2)科学研究的需要The second, animal testing is the most predominant form of testing used by scientists. Animal research plays a vital, and irreplaceable, role in such fields as drug and cancer research.The phase of research on animals gave us essential data which moved us on. The knowledge so gained is being used to provide more effective treatment for seriously disabled humans.The results they yield bring a new outlook on life for millions around the world. If animal testing is banned, how will medicines be developed? Will cures have to be tried only on humans? Will there be enough volunteers? How about lawsuits by families of victims of imperfectly designed cures? A complete ban on animal testing will have very serious negative effects on medical research. I believe that developing better, more effective and safer drugs is more important than sparing a few rats. (反驳正方观点)Alternatives to animal testing must be developed but even these alternatives will require animal testing in order to compare results. Will the animal rights activists endorse(赞同) any responsibility of the disastrous effects of their rosy cuddly thoughts? I doubt it.. 分论点(3)安全性需要The third, It is imperative(必要的) that all drugs released onto the market are safe for humans to use. I feel that animal testing is necessary for the continuation of biological and safety research. Even with animal & people testing, dangerous products still get on the market, imagine how many more will be on the market if we ban animal testing. 论点2:物竞天择 Animal rights protesters are just a bunch of city dwellers who dont really understand how life works. Nature is predatory, the strongest survive, and by testing drugs and medical research on animals which creates cures for human diseases, then those animals died to help us survive.
